Why Dark Web Sites Don't Appear on Google

Google's search crawlers can't access the Tor network because it's designed to be invisible to standard internet protocols. Dark web sites use .onion addresses, which require the Tor browser to resolve. Google's bots don't run Tor, so they never see these pages. Additionally, most dark web sites deliberately block search engine crawlers through robots.txt files or technical barriers. This isn't a limitation of Google—it's an intentional feature of how the dark web was built. The anonymity that makes the dark web valuable for privacy also makes it unsearchable through conventional means.

How Dark Web Sites on Tor Actually Work

Dark web sites on Tor operate through a series of encrypted relays that bounce your connection through multiple nodes, obscuring your IP address and location. When you access a .onion site, your traffic is encrypted end-to-end, making it invisible to ISPs and network monitors. These sites are hosted on servers that are themselves hidden, with addresses that are cryptographic hashes rather than traditional domain names. The Tor network was originally developed by the U.S. Naval Research Laboratory and remains the most reliable way to access dark web content. Understanding this architecture helps explain why Google's search technology simply doesn't apply to these networks.

Legal Uses of Dark Web Sites on Tor

The dark web hosts legitimate resources including privacy-focused email services, uncensored news archives, and forums for discussing sensitive topics safely. Journalists use Tor to communicate with sources in countries with internet restrictions. Activists and dissidents rely on dark web sites to organize and share information beyond government surveillance. Academic researchers study privacy technologies and network security using Tor infrastructure. Whistleblowing platforms operate on the dark web to protect sources. Libraries and book archives preserve information that might be censored in certain regions. These legal uses demonstrate that the dark web isn't inherently criminal—it's a tool for privacy that serves important purposes. Understanding the legitimate side helps distinguish it from illegal marketplaces.

Safety Practices for Dark Web Browsing

Never maximize your browser window on the dark web, as this reveals your screen resolution and can aid in fingerprinting. Disable JavaScript in Tor Browser settings to prevent malicious scripts from compromising anonymity. Keep your operating system and all software fully updated before accessing dark web sites. Use a dedicated device or virtual machine if possible to isolate dark web activity. Assume every site could be a honeypot or scam—verify information through multiple sources. Never download files unless absolutely necessary, and scan them with antivirus software. Don't enable plugins or extensions in Tor Browser. Avoid mixing Tor usage with regular browsing on the same device. These practices significantly reduce the risk of malware, phishing, and deanonymization.

What's the difference between the dark web and deep web?

The deep web includes any internet content not indexed by Google, like email accounts and paywalled databases. The dark web is a small part of the deep web that's intentionally hidden and requires Tor or similar tools to access. Most deep web content is perfectly legal and everyday. The dark web adds encryption and anonymity on top of being hidden from search engines.

Is accessing the dark web illegal?

Accessing the dark web itself is legal in most countries. Using Tor Browser is not a crime. However, many activities on the dark web are illegal, including buying drugs or stolen data. The legality depends on what you do, not on the technology you use. Journalists, activists, and privacy-conscious people use the dark web legally every day.
